首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

git rebase;如何快进

git rebase是一种用于合并分支的Git命令。它的作用是将一个分支上的提交应用到另一个分支上,使得两个分支的提交历史线变得更加线性。

具体来说,git rebase命令可以将当前分支上的提交按照顺序应用到目标分支上。这个过程中,Git会将当前分支上的提交复制一份,并在目标分支上逐个应用这些提交。这样,就可以将当前分支上的提交整合到目标分支上,形成一个更加线性的提交历史。

使用git rebase命令可以实现快进合并(fast-forward merge),即将目标分支指针直接指向当前分支的最新提交。这种合并方式不会产生新的合并提交,只是简单地将目标分支指针移动到当前分支的最新提交上。

要进行快进合并,可以按照以下步骤操作:

  1. 确保当前所在分支是目标分支,可以使用git checkout命令切换到目标分支。
  2. 使用git merge命令进行快进合并,例如git merge <branch>,其中<branch>是当前分支上的一个提交。
  3. 如果快进合并成功,Git会提示"Already up to date",表示目标分支已经包含了当前分支的所有提交。

快进合并适用于以下情况:

  • 当前分支没有新的提交,只是在目标分支的基础上进行了修改。
  • 当前分支的提交历史线是线性的,没有分叉。

关于git rebase的更多详细信息,可以参考腾讯云的产品文档:Git 分支管理 - 变基

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券